Output e70fcc26f0222a5a51ff45dd2b082eb606d4b1b9559d245e1c45ee67c6b5f01e:1

value
312124524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d107cb4eef8b86174e27a24952dc15b45b57ef OP_EQUAL
address
3Bhfz9GEBiVMYdUhoQtFN8Gq4upbTqZxXv
transaction
e70fcc26f0222a5a51ff45dd2b082eb606d4b1b9559d245e1c45ee67c6b5f01e
spent
true